21 wins in a row: Aurora Gaming win DreamLeague Division 2 Season 3
In the grand final of DreamLeague Division 2 Season 3, Aurora Gaming confidently defeated Nigma Galaxy 3–0 to become tournament champions, securing a slot at DreamLeague Season 28 and $15,000 in prize money. Nigma finished second and received $10,000 from the total prize pool.
All three maps were fully controlled by Aurora, while Nigma’s attempts to diversify their draft brought no result. Confident performances from every player in their respective roles shut down any effort from their opponents to gain momentum.
At this event, Egor Nightfall Grigorenko’s squad finished the group stage with seven wins and then confidently advanced through the upper bracket. The victory marked the roster’s 21st consecutive win, and so far no opponent has managed to stop them.
The winning streak began in the closed qualifiers for ESL One Birmingham 2026, where the team secured their spot by defeating every opponent in the lower bracket. Aurora then advanced through the Play-In stage of FISSURE Universe: Episode 8 and eventually won the tournament without dropping a single series. On their way to the title, the team defeated BetBoom, Team Yandex and Team Spirit twice.
It is worth noting that the team continues to compete with Artem lorenof Melnik, who is temporarily replacing Rafli Mikoto Fathur due to visa issues.

DreamLeague Division 2 Season 3 took place from 04.02.2026 to 12.02.2026 in an online format, where eight teams competed for a slot at DreamLeague Season 28 and a $50,000 prize pool.
